Transaction 581aece4d04f8a889233586dd2f5ce821518e045ba96defb92f5ce9b5ee4eeaa
1 Input
2 Outputs
- 581aece4d04f8a889233586dd2f5ce821518e045ba96defb92f5ce9b5ee4eeaa:0
- 581aece4d04f8a889233586dd2f5ce821518e045ba96defb92f5ce9b5ee4eeaa:1
value 40000000
address 1AJS9c762giNXkXUDDmjV8JJcjC7su8Mqs
value 59914129
address 1FHnP6DLZSW35qiqhHHkYRbuNS1YTPVT5U